Arcane, your question caught me off guard. Much as the RMIL thread was the Mork thread, the same players have made this the Wellrich thread instead of the ANTI thread.

Interestingly, the $1.1m revenue projection wasn't the only one made for the first quarter of 1998. A later, and hence presumably more soundly based, revenue projection was made on Dec. 2, 1997 and projected 1Q98 sales of $2.7m ( #reply-5638745 ).
Actual 1Q98 revenues per the unaudited 10-Q were $44,430.96 representing a shortfall of about $2.65 million or 98.4% from the projection made about one month before the start of that quarter.
( www4.edgar-online.com )

Will someone tell me again why we should listen to any predictions issued by this company?
